Holistic Member Development

By integrating leadership, academic support, and service opportunities, members develop into responsible, values-driven citizens, because sustained personal growth is most effective when intellectual, ethical, and civic dimensions are nurtured together. This strategy emphasizes the interconnected development of the individual through a balanced focus on leadership, education, and community engagement. Unlike programs that prioritize only service or only academic support, this approach fosters long-term personal and social responsibility by embedding all three components within a shared values framework. It is particularly effective in youth and student populations where identity and civic orientation are still forming.

  • Child Abuse Prevention Funding and Events KAPPA DELTA SORORITY - THETA KAPPA
    direct service
    Kappa Delta has donated over $35 million to child abuse prevention efforts and hosts annual Shamrock events nationwide to raise funds for this cause, offering members community service opportunities through Prevent Child Abuse America.

  • Internship Opportunities KAPPA DELTA SORORITY - THETA KAPPA
    direct service
    Kappa Delta provides internship opportunities at the Georgia O’Keeffe in Santa Fe, New Mexico, the orthopaedic laboratory at the University of Tennessee Health Science Center in Memphis, Tennessee, and Prevent Child Abuse America in Chicago, IL.
  • Member scholarship awards KAPPA DELTA SORORITY - THETA KAPPA
    direct service
    The Kappa Delta Foundation awards over $600,000 in scholarships each year to support the educational pursuits of its members.

  • Partnership with Girl Scouts of the USA KAPPA DELTA SORORITY - THETA KAPPA
    direct service
    Kappa Delta members engage in joint programming with Girl Scouts of the USA, working directly with more than 14,000 girls annually through community service and leadership development initiatives.
